logo

Output eabad8a7438b313856f07ffd6b6ada23f23b841cdd66765be59eca6e19534c06:1

value
33368161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3668dd07280f83233c4bae270d6ef7c57d24df OP_EQUAL
address
3HfTMZVEKRybPaA5gZWLt8G79FYFXiB4Tp
transaction
eabad8a7438b313856f07ffd6b6ada23f23b841cdd66765be59eca6e19534c06